Advice for parents

To help lessons run smoothly :

  • Please arrive at the designated meeting point for your lesson.
  • Present your lesson card to the instructor at the meeting point.
  • Ensure you have a valid ski pass before the lesson begins. Ski passes are not included in the lesson price and are required to access the ski lifts.
  • Equipment is not provided. Please make sure your equipment is suitable for your height, weight and ability level.
  • esf does not provide insurance cover for its pupils. We therefore recommend that you check your personal insurance cover or take out suitable ski insurance if required.
  • Please inform us if your child has any medical conditions or specific health requirements.
  • If you have chosen the meal option, please let us know about any food allergies or dietary requirements.
  • To help your child settle into their group, please avoid waiting in front of the Children's Village or following them during lessons, as this may affect their progress and confidence.
  • Decisions regarding changes of level are made solely by the instructors.

Preparing for your child's arrival (ages 3–4)

  • Please note: you will be asked to provide proof of your child's identity on arrival.
  • You will need to go to reception to collect your course card.
  • Take your course card to the level sign where the instructors in blue will be waiting for you.
  • If you have chosen the meal option, please inform us of any allergies or dietary requirements. The weekly menu is displayed at reception.
  • Please provide a small bag labelled with your child's name containing: comforter and dummy, sunglasses or ski mask, sun cream, tissues, snack and a drink.
  • Please label your child's skis and helmet with their first name. Labels are available from reception.
  • Please note that we reserve the right to withdraw a child from the programme if they are not fully toilet trained.

Choose your ski pass

Your ski pass is required for all lessons and is not included in the lesson price
  • From the very first day, your child will need a ski pass adapted to their age and level to take part in the lessons.
  • It can be purchased at the ski lift ticket offices.
Our recommendations based on age and ability level
Ski
Free ski pass
  • Children aged 3 and 4
    Free ski pass available from the lift pass offices.

Avoriaz ski pass
  • Beginners aged 5 and over: Ourson, Flocon, 1ère étoile and 2ème étoile

Portes du Soleil ski pass
  • Suitable for children at 3ème Étoile, Étoile de Bronze, Étoile d'Argent, Étoile d'Or, Competition (Flèche & Chamois) and Team Rider levels.

Material and equipment

To welcome your child in the best conditions, please bring :
  • Appropriate ski clothing: ski trousers, ski jacket, hat, sunglasses or ski goggles, mittens or gloves, sunscreen and tissues.
  • Ski or snowboard equipment suitable for your child's height, weight and ability level.
  • Helmets are compulsory.
  • Please remember to label your child's clothing and equipment.
For Children Aged 3–4
  • Please provide a small bag labelled with your child's name containing:
    a comforter or favourite soft toy (if required), a dummy (if required), sunglasses or ski goggles, sunscreen, tissues, a snack and a drink.

Optional animation

Extend your day with peace of mind
From 4:00pm, after skiing, your child can continue enjoying their day at the Children's Village with our entertainment programme, available as an optional add-on when booking.

Supervised by our team of activity leaders, children can enjoy a fun-filled programme tailored to their age group, including face painting, shows, games, puppet shows and surprise activities. The programme changes every day, offering new opportunities for fun, creativity and discovery.

The perfect option for parents who would like childcare until the end of the day, and for children who simply can't get enough of the Children's Village!

Good to know:
  • If you choose the entertainment programme option, your child must be collected at 5:30pm. Early collection will not be possible.
  • For your child's safety, an activity leader will be present at collection time to check the arrangements provided by parents, including the identity of the person authorised to collect the child.
  • Please note: entertainment activities are not available on Fridays. Children must therefore be collected at 4:00pm.
